A Republic of Rivers Three Centuries of Nature Writing from Alaska and the Yukon
This selection of Arctic-American literature covers both Alaska and the Yukon and includes writings by literary figures, missionaries, explorers, climbers, miners, scientists, backpackers, fishermen and native people, with a common theme of 'wild nature'. Selections date from 1741 to 1989.
